WebThe Illinois Jury Act says getting out of jury duty depends on your: Job; Business affairs; Physical health; Family situation; Active duty status in the Illinois National Guard or Illinois Naval Militia, or; Other personal affairs; … WebVirginia has a statutory exemption that allows individuals over a certain age to request exemption from jury duty. Citizens over the age of 70 can be exempt from jury service under this age exception. A prospective juror may check the box on the Juror Questionnaire indicating that they are more than 70 years of age and do not wish to serve. WebYou need to make a request to defer your jury service in writing using the back of the jury qualification questionnaire. Please give the reason why you need to be deferred and when would be a better time for your to serve as a juror within a 6-month period. The questionnaire still needs to be completed and returned to the Court. canadian tire in store fire tables
